Phenobarbital (CAS: 50-06-6, C12H12N2O3) is a barbiturate derivative with a molecular weight of 232.24 g/mol. It functions as a central nervous system depressant. Historically, it has been used for its sedative, hypnotic, and anticonvulsant properties. Phenobarbital is a controlled substance in many jurisdictions due to its potential for dependence and misuse.

Anticonvulsant Therapy

Phenobarbital is employed in the management of various seizure disorders, including epilepsy. Its mechanism of action involves enhancing inhibitory neurotransmission.

Sedative and Hypnotic Agent

Historically, Phenobarbital has been used for its sedative effects to manage anxiety and insomnia, though its use for these indications has largely been superseded by safer alternatives.

Research Chemical

This compound serves as a valuable tool in pharmacological and neuroscientific research to study GABAergic pathways and CNS depressant effects.

What are the primary safety concerns when handling Phenobarbital?

+

Phenobarbital is a highly toxic substance, indicated by GHS06 and GHS08 symbols and a 'Danger' signal word. It carries hazard statements H301 (Toxic if swallowed), H317 (May cause an allergic skin reaction), H351 (Suspected of causing cancer), and H360D (May damage the unborn child). Strict adherence to safety protocols, including appropriate personal protective equipment like gloves, eyeshields, and respiratory protection, is essential.

Is Phenobarbital a controlled substance?

+

Yes, Phenobarbital is a controlled substance. It is listed under US DEA Schedule IV and is regulated in other jurisdictions, with specific restrictions on availability, including being unavailable from Canada.
